Two particles each have a mass of 6.0 xx 10^(-3) kg. One has a charge of +5.0 xx 10^(-6) C. and the other has a charge of -5.0 xx 10^(-6) C. They are initially held at rest at a distance of 0.80 m apart. Both are then released and accelerate toward each other. How fast is each particle moving when the separation between them is one-third its initial value? |
|
Answer» `7.3` m/s |
